Transaction 37513332d723367f6d3dd57efb209daed15520dd3205b628a1eb08e6875bd20b
1 Input
1 Output
-
37513332d723367f6d3dd57efb209daed15520dd3205b628a1eb08e6875bd20b:0
- value
- 450900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7b6fe4c8ab3196a93a8a866d24485eb406a9dba OP_EQUAL
- address
- 3QGp3XXSAz9dHMJdHEmwif5rLKdxnKgBuT